X958 XJT is a 2001 Opel Zafira in Blue with a 1,796c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.
Across all 2001 Opel Zafira models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.1% with a typical mileage of 93,144 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Opel Zafira f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 1,696 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X958 XJT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Opel Zafira typ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 25 years old, this Opel Zafira is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
